The Destruction of a Church of Taliena
A Church to Taliena on the northeast coast of Tropica was recently destroyed by Malachive in the name of Chaos. Ruins are all that remains there, along with a symbol of chaos magically etched into the air, and beheaded statue of the Goddess. Llwellyn: The Church of Light
Sat Jun 9 22:32:48 2012
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Greetings to thee,
Throughout the years and through the dedication of many, the Church of Light has
constructed temples to the Gods of Light on many continents. This missive
is for those who did not know of their location and would wish to visit them.
All who come in peace and good will are welcome.
On Althainia, from Market Square in the Althainia Kingdom travel three
leagues east, three north, five west, north then east. Thou wilt find a temple
dedicated to each of the Gods of Light.
Upon Arkane, travel all east through Arkane, five leagues beyond outside
the east gate, to the north thou wilt find a temple dedicated to Siccara.
Also on Arkane, go to the bind stone west of the city, travel three leagues
south then twice east. Thou wilt find a Haven and hospital for thy ills.
On Tropica, travel southwest from the port, then a league west and
then south again. Thou wilt find a Temple of Light dedicated to all
the Gods of Light as well as a hospital to cure thy illness and
heal thy wounds.
Upon Icewall, traveling from the port go all northwards until thee
reaches the temple dedicated to Nadrik, travel east and thou wilt find
the Sanctuary of the Light, a place of refuge and a hospital. One can
get most minor ailments and sicknesses cured such as suffers the wandering
traveller.
May the blessings of Siccara shine upon thee, may Her light heal
thee and grant thee comfort from thy pain,
Monsignor Llwellyn Skye
Chosen of Siccara
Priestess of the Church of Light

Datai: A Guide to Siccara's Temples
Wed Oct 19 22:09:05 2011
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Many years ago during the era of temple building, Siccara's faithful lead
the way ensuring that havens to rest and heal in body and spirit could be
easily found by the weary traveler. These structures still stand today,
and I offer this brief guide for the weary traveler or devout pilgrim that
you may find and enjoy these gifts.
Upon Arkania:
Haven of Light
In the forest west of Arkane and north of Balifore's ruins, this building
serves as both temple and hospital. From Arkania's public port, travel
west five miles to the bindstone. From there, travel south three miles,
and then east to the Haven.
Temple of Siccara
On the road east of the city of Arkane, this temple features a few books
of prayers and devotions. Feel free to keep a copy if you so wish, scribes
still restock the books regularly. This temple can be found 26 miles
(straight through the heart of Arkane city) from Arkania's public port, and
is on the north side of the road.
Upon Althainia:
The Church of Light
The Church of Light stands as the most ambitious building project of the
Annaid Aingeal. Situated within Althainia's city walls, north of Crown
Street, all six Gods of Good have temples dedicated to them here. From
Althainia's market square, travel three blocks west, three blocks north, two
blocks east, north into the gardens, and then east into the Church. The
Temple dedicated to Siccara is on the southwest side of the complex.
Upon Tropica:
Temple of Light
This temple to our Gods of Good also serves as a hospital in Siccara's
spirit. Travel south from Tropica's public port, two miles west, and then
south.
Siccara bless you on your travels,
Lady Datai d'Aggravaine, Songstress of Siccara
